This Beverly Hills Post Office short sale “appears” to be a new listing...on the MLS for 3 days, but it’s actually an extended listing. It was listed about 2 ½ months ago with another agent as a “Notice of Default” sale, for $1,895,000.
The home did not sell, and is now listed with another agent as a short sale for $1,795,000. And while it is a great location up in the hills, adjacent to the Vineyard Beverly Hills Estates...the comps show that the price is still too high.
This is a mid century home, built in 1958 with 3,024 sqft, but much of the sought after architectural details are MIA. I wonder if the vaulted ceilings were lined with wood back in the day?
The home definitely takes advantageous of the gorgeous views, and does so with the stereotypical “walls of glass” that the coveted mid century homes are known for.
The floor plan does include the open spaces popular of this era, as evidenced in the great room, and to some extent in the kitchen, with the eat-in-dining area.
The grounds are lovely, and there is room for a pool.
The bedrooms are a little sleepy, but they are spacious and the master bedroom has a charming fireplace.
